On March 19, 2024 at 10:55 am, Licensing Program Analyst (LPA) Jessica Rubio arrived at the facility to conduct an annual inspection as part of a compliance review. LPA met with Licensee Donisha Adams toured the facility, inside and out, records were reviewed, and the following was observed and/or discussed: \302\267 Normal days and hours of operation are: Monday through Friday 6:30 am to 6:00 pm \302\267 Off-limit areas include: Entire second story, downstairs bedroom and garage. \302\267 The facility is licensed to have no more than 14 children as a large family child care home and is operating within the licensed capacity and appropriate ratios. LPA observed seven children in care with a licensee and one assistant providing care. \302\267 Appropriate supervision was being provided during this inspection \302\267 A working telephone is present, and the current phone number is on file \302\267 A fully charged fire extinguisher (2A:10BC) was observed. A smoke detector and carbon monoxide detector were present and tested by the Licensee during this inspection. \302\267 All hazardous items are stored inaccessible to children. \302\267 Toxins are locked and inaccessible to children in care. \302\267 Weapons are not present as stated by Licensee Donisha Adams. Licensee understands all guns, weapons and ammunition must be key locked separately and made inaccessible per Title 22 Regulations \302\267 Stairs are barricaded \302\267 Clean, safe, and age-appropriate toys are provided \302\267 Current roster on file \302\267 Facility Sketch, Emergency Disaster Plan and Notification of Parent\342\200\231s Rights poster are posted \302\267 Documentation of fire and disaster drills are on file \342\200\223 Last drill was conducted on 1/10/2024. \302\267 There is an in ground pool located in the backyard. The pool is surrounded by vinyl perimeter fencing and 5' high mesh fencing. The mesh fencing has a gate however, the gate was not closing and self-latching properly. A citation will be issued. Licensee understands all bodies of water including ponds, above ground pools & spas, in-ground pools & spas, and some fountains must be properly covered or fenced per Title 22 Regulations. The Department must be notified before and after installation of the above types of bodies of water. In addition, all wading pools or similar product must be emptied immediately after use and stored in an upright position. \302\267 Verification of control of property is on file \302\267 LPA reviewed five children\342\200\231s files. All children\342\200\231s records were complete. \302\267 LPA reviewed one employee file. Assistant was missing documentation of immunizations. A citation will be issued. \302\267 Licensee\342\200\231s Mandated Reporter Training expires on 5/2024 \302\267 Licensee\342\200\231s Pediatric CPR and First Aid Card expires on 8/2025 \302\267 Licensee completed Health & Safety Certificate on 10/8/2017 \302\267 Resident and/or staff records were reviewed and all adults who require caregiver background checks have received all required clearances and/or exemptions. What does Type A vs Type B mean?

Type A. Serious citation. Imminent or substantial risk to children. The regulator requires corrective action immediately and may impose a civil penalty.

Type B. Lower-severity citation. Corrective action required, no imminent risk. The regulator monitors compliance on the next visit.

  • OPERATION OF A FAMILY CHILD CARE HOME

    Based on observation, the licensee did not comply with the section cited above as the pool gate is not working properly and and self-latching which poses a potential health, safety or personal rights risk to persons in care.

  • Family Day Care Homes

    Based on record review, the licensee did not comply with the section cited above as assistant did not have documentation of imunizations on file, which poses a potential health, safety or personal rights risk to persons in care.
